La Tourangelle Roasted Walnut Oil is a premium, handcrafted oil made from California walnuts using a 150-year-old French roasting method. Lightly filtered and expeller-pressed, it delivers a rich, nutty flavor and provides 1.23g of heart-healthy Omega-3 fatty acids per serving. Ideal for cooking, baking, and finishing dishes, it comes in sustainable BPA-free tin packaging, perfect for the mindful, flavor-driven professional.

Walnut Oil Fan - Who Knew All the Benefits?
Really enjoying this Walnut Oil. After reading about the health benefits (Omega-3's) I wanted to try some, since I already like eating walnuts (by the way - a walnut and melted cheese sandwich on toasted bread... awesome). You can mix 4 TBSP Walnut oil, with 1 TBSP Balsamic Vinegar, and 1 TSP Dijon Mustard plus a little salt and pepper for an amazing salad dressing. Better than store bought prepared stuff full of sugar and soybean oil, no comparison. Interesting flavor - bold and nutty. Also good for wood preservation without using toxic oils. Huge fan now of Walnut Oil.

Best pound cake surprise ingredient
Add this to cake batter and cookies. Not for frying as the oil will become bitter if slightly browned. A wonderful aroma and taste in muffins and scones!!
